Native America at the new millennium.

Description: 

Native America at the New Millennium (NANM) is a Ford Foundation-funded collaboration by the Harvard Project, Native Nations Institute, and First Nations Development Institute that serves as a primer on contemporary American Indian affairs. NANM addresses topics as wide-ranging as tribal government, non-profit organizations, political activism, economic development, housing, welfare, health, arts, and media. Through its scope, NANM provides a big picture of the issues facing American Indian nations and individuals today; through its detailed footnotes and references, NANM is an invaluable introduction to the intricate and often labyrinthine sources of American Indian policy and data. This report is to be published as a book.
